              As of now, RPI is planning on opening in the Fall and competing athletically, but I would not be surprised if they start with no fans allowed at the games. It would be unfortunate, but I will take any type of season given to us.
              Small D3 institutions, like RPI, banning fans from D3 games is not really all that big a deal to the institution. The budgets for those sports are essentially declared a virtual total loss the day they are established anyway. Knowing this, it is easy to imagine that a significant number of D3 institutions will do exactly that. The income passed on and lost by doing this is basically irrelevant or, in IRS or accounting lingo, nominal and gratuitous.

              However, a small D3 school taking on the huge financial commitment necessary to run a play up D1 sport and then playing to no fans for any or all of the season does not appear to be a very realistic option. Costs involved would pretty much remain very high but there would be virtually no revenue to even partially offset those costs. No ticket sales income, no parking lot income, no game program income, no advertising in the game program income, no booster club donation income, no concession stand rental or sales income and, of course, no corporate advertising on either the boards, the ice or the video board income. Passing on and losing this level of income is akin to economic kamikaze suicide.
